Résumé

This article sheds light on the administration’s critical role in preparing the school team, and particularly teachers in professional insertion, to resolve ethical issues as a team. Four avenues are explored: developing an ethical framework for each school team member, creating a space conducive to sharing values and principles, updating knowledge of the professional framework, and implementing procedures for resolving ethical problems as they arise.
